Thesis (Ph.D.) - Cairo University - Faculty of Physical Therapy - Department of Physical Therapy for Neuromuscular and Neurosurgery
The purpose of this study was to investigate the efficacy of galvanic vestibular stimulation on balance in patients with parkinson`s disease. thirty patients with parkinson`s disease from both sexes participated in this study
